The Great Polar Bear Feast

2015 · Movie · 54 min · ★ 6.0

Documentary

Every year, normally solitary polar bears gather in large numbers of eighty or more at Kaktovic, Alaska, waiting to feast on the bone pile left from the traditional Bowhead Whale cull by the local Inupiat Tribe residence.
